What It Does
Parses server log files to extract key statistics: top requesting IPs, most frequent status codes, popular URLs, error counts, and suspicious patterns like repeated login failures.
How It Works
Uses regex patterns to parse common log formats (nginx combined, Apache common/combined, syslog). Aggregates data and identifies anomalies.
Supported Formats
- nginx/Apache combined log format
- Apache common log format
- Syslog format
- auth.log format
Use Cases
- Investigate brute-force login attempts
- Identify top traffic sources
- Find error spikes and their causes
- Detect suspicious access patterns
